PHP : Une nouvelle fondation pour aider ce langage de programmation essentiel

PHP, l’un des langages de programmation les plus populaires, va être soutenu par la création d’une nouvelle fondation pour assurer son avenir. PHP, créé par Rasmus Lerdorf en 1995, est un langage populaire à apprendre, notamment parce qu’il est utilisé dans environ 78 % des sites web du monde, selon les données de W3Techs. Le fabricant d’IDE […]

Read More

Cinq conseils pour améliorer la fiabilité des logiciels

À une époque où le DevOps est devenu une nécessité et où personne ne peut se permettre d’avoir des pannes ou même des ralentissements, la pratique de l’ingénierie de la fiabilité de sites (SRE) est devenue incontournable. Les compétences en SRE, qui relient les opérations et le développement, sont très demandés. Selon une récente étude […]

Read More

Arrêtez de faire des transitions agiles !

D’après le rapport « State Of Agile » de Digital.ai, c’est principalement au sein des départements IT que les méthodes agiles sont utilisées. Cependant, ce même rapport met en avant quelques obstacles à leur adoption et à leur extension : résistance au changement au sein de l’organisation, manque de leadership, incohérence des processus et des […]

Read More

Le déficit de compétences informatiques s’aggrave. Voici 10 façons d’éviter la crise

La crise des compétences informatiques est plus grave que jamais. Et les DSI doivent créer des stratégies de recrutement et de rétention efficaces s’ils veulent attirer les talents dont leurs projets de transformation numérique ont désespérément besoin. C’est la principale conclusion du rapport sur le leadership numérique du recruteur Harvey Nash Group, qui montre que […]

Read More

Twitter remanie sa plateforme pour les développeurs et met à niveau son API

Twitter a déployé d’importantes mises à jour de sa plateforme de développement dans le but de promouvoir l’innovation, en particulier lorsque les solutions sont conçues pour le « bien commun ». Le 15 novembre, la plateforme de microblogging a déclaré que les mises à jour, qui sont parmi les plus importantes de l’entreprise à ce […]

Read More

Explosion de la demande en compétences technologiques, fort intérêt pour les solutions “low-code” et “no-code”

Les années 2020 s’annoncent comme l’époque la plus intensive sur le plan numérique. Mais il y a un hic. Il n’y a pas assez de développeurs et d’ingénieurs pour construire les choses dont nous avons besoin. Que vous soyez un entrepreneur en herbe sans support informatique ou que vous dirigiez la division d’une entreprise internationale […]

Read More

Programmation : Une palette des langages populaires et qui se développent rapidement

Selon une enquête menée auprès de plus de 19 000 codeurs, JavaScript est désormais utilisé par plus de 16,4 millions de développeurs dans le monde, ce qui en fait le langage de programmation le plus populaire “de loin”. Le 21ème rapport Developer Nation de SlashData a examiné les tendances mondiales des développeurs de logiciels dans […]

Read More

Microsoft veut amener Excel au-delà des chiffres et du texte

Microsoft a mis à jour Excel pour permettre aux développeurs de créer leurs propres types de données personnalisées dans le célèbre tableur. Cette mise à jour n’est pas destinée aux chefs d’entreprise qui utilisent Excel, mais aux développeurs qui ont besoin de manipuler des métadonnées dans les cellules Excel. Excel a toujours été conçu pour […]

Read More

Tout comprendre à Java

La première version utilisable de Java sort officiellement le 23 mai 1995. La genèse du projet remonte à 1991, avec le projet Oak, mené par une petite équipe de Sun Microsystems. Trois ingénieurs, Naughton, Sheridan et Gosling, montent une petite équipe, Green Team. L’objectif est de créer l’informatique du futur. Rapidement, ils travaillent sur la convergence numérique des […]

Read More

Apple met à jour les règles de l’App Store sur les paiements alternatifs

Apple a mis à jour ses directives d’examen de l’App Store afin de tenir compte de l’accord conclu fin août avec des développeurs américains qui avaient contacté des clients au sujet de méthodes de paiement alternatives en dehors d’une application iOS. Après le règlement, Apple a déclaré qu’elle autoriserait les développeurs à utiliser des moyens […]

Read More

Calculatrice graphique NumWorks : Oui, les calculatrices existent toujours, et elles fonctionnent avec Python

Regardez. Ce petit bonhomme est resté au fond de mes tiroirs de bureau pendant plus de deux décennies. Cela fait plus de 20 ans que je n’ai pas acheté une calculatrice physique, une calculatrice qui tient dans la main. J’ai depuis acheté quelques applications mobiles de calculatrices. Mais la toute dernière calculatrice physique que j’ai […]

Read More

Rabourdin : Comment une PME industrielle s’approprie le digital

Impossible de transformer en pleine tempête lorsqu’on est une PME, plus encore après un redressement judiciaire et un rachat ? C’est pourtant l’objectif que s’était fixé le repreneur de Rabourdin, le groupe ACI. Si après un an, beaucoup reste à faire, notamment au niveau de l’outil industriel, l’entreprise tire un premier bilan positif des transformations engagées. […]

Read More

Utiliser un outil SAST “developer-first“ pour augmenter la productivité des développeurs sans compromettre la sécurité

En effet, les développeurs peuvent identifier les failles de sécurité pendant qu’ils codent, afin de les détecter dès qu’elles apparaissent et les corriger, réduisant ainsi leur charge de travail future en diminuant les éventuels problèmes qu’ils devront résoudre plus tard. Mais les outils SAST (Static application security testing) traditionnels se sont révélés peu adaptés aux […]

Read More

Les langages de programmation les plus faciles à apprendre

Les langages de programmation indiquent aux ordinateurs comment effectuer des tâches spécifiques. Les langages de programmation complexes, avec une syntaxe dense et des fonctions compliquées, peuvent mettre à l’épreuve même les codeurs expérimentés. Les professionnels de la programmation qui souhaitent apprendre un nouveau langage peuvent préférer une option plus facile. Notre liste présente les langages […]

Read More

API, une définition en un clic

L’Application Programming Interface, ou API, c’est du code logiciel permettant d’interconnecter des systèmes et des applications. Leur usage s’est développé à l’ère du web 2.0, pour exploser avec l’adoption du cloud computing. Si à l’ère du cloud et des microservices, l’API est un composant essentiel, sa création est cependant bien antérieure. L’apparition des premières API précède […]

Read More

Open source : Google lance un SOS, et va payer les développeurs

Google soutient un nouveau projet de la Fondation Linux à hauteur d’un million de dollars, qui vise à renforcer la sécurité des projets open source critiques. Plutôt qu’un bug bounty, le dernier investissement de Google – qui s’inscrit dans le cadre de son engagement récent dans un projet global de 10 milliards de dollars en faveur […]

Read More

La plus belle annonce que l’on peut faire à un développeur web : Google Search fait ses adieux à Internet Explorer 11

Google Search, le plus important produit de la société mère de Google, Alphabet, a enfin abandonné la prise en charge d’Internet Explorer 11 (IE 11), l’ancien navigateur de Microsoft. Selon 9to5Google, Google a abandonné la prise en charge d’IE 11 parce que le navigateur ne représente désormais qu’une petite partie des navigateurs utilisés pour Google Search. La nouvelle […]

Read More

Pourquoi faire des robots logiciels nos alliés ?

Bien qu’un tel sentiment soit tout à fait légitime , il est temps de percevoir les robots sous un autre angle : en tant qu’alliés. Contrairement à certaines idées reçues, la collaboration entre les humains et les ressources numériques est gage d’efficacité, d’augmentation des revenus et garant de la satisfaction des collaborateurs qui seront aussi […]

Read More

DevOps, une définition en un clic

Dans la continuité de l’Agile, le DevOps, contraction de Développement et Opérations, vise à rapprocher les développeurs et les opérations IT dans le but d’accélérer la mise en production d’applications, en particulier sur le cloud. L’informatique raffole des (belles) histoires, comme la naissance d’Apple dans un garage. La naissance du DevOps a elle aussi son […]

Read More

Stack Overflow a créé un clavier spécialement pour copier/coller du code

Le site de Q & A pour développeurs Stack Overflow a particulièrement réussi son poisson d’avril de l’année dernière, en faisant une fausse annonce sur le lancement d’un clavier “copier/coller” à trois touches. Il s’agissait d’une blague d’initiés, un clin d’œil à la pratique courante des développeurs qui copient et collent des bouts de code, partagés par […]

Read More